What Is a Urine Drug Screen?

In the state of Grandview, IA, a urine drug screen is an integral method for analyzing a urine sample to detect drugs and their metabolites. As the most prevalently employed testing technique in workplace and regulatory settings, it is favored for its non-intrusive nature, economical cost, and broad-spectrum detection abilities over a practical timeframe.

  • It is collected under strict chain-of-custody protocols essential for regulated testing environments.
  • Capable of detecting both the parent drug and its metabolites excreted in the urine.
  • The results indicate prior exposure to substances within a determinate detection window, as opposed to presenting evidence of current impairment.

Why Organizations Use Urine Drug Screening

  • Facilitates pre-employment screening to foster a safe and drug-free workplace environment in Grandview, IA.
  • Supports procedures like random checks, post-accident analysis, reasonable suspicion investigations, and assessments after an employee's return to duty.
  • Ensures adherence to regulatory standards within safety-sensitive sectors.
  • Helps in monitoring compliance with prescribed medication or designated treatment programs.

How It Works

Collection

  • In Grandview, IA, donors are expected to provide their specimen in a secure container, under observation or unobserved depending on specific program guidelines.
  • Checks to ensure specimen validity may involve measurements of creatinine, specific gravity, and pH.

Testing Methodology

Interpreting Results

  • In Grandview, IA, the initial phase involves immunoassay screening, offering a swift and affordable evaluation method.
  • For presumptive positive results, confirmatory testing (e.g., GC/MS or LC/MS/MS) is employed.
  • Cutoff levels, expressed in nanograms per milliliter (ng/mL), define whether the results are positive or negative.

Detection Windows

The detection of substances depends on factors such as the type of substance, frequency of usage, metabolic rate, hydration levels, body composition, and testing sensitivity in Grandview, IA. Typically, many substances may be detected for a period ranging from one to three days, while certain drugs, like cannabinoids in habitual users, might be detectable over a longer span.

Key Considerations for Regulated (e.g., DOT) Programs

  • Adhere strictly to relevant federal regulations and utilize laboratories that carry certification.
  • Ensure that collection is undertaken by trained, qualified personnel, maintaining an unimpeachable chain-of-custody.
  • Incorporate testing procedures to validate specimen authenticity and deter potential adulteration.
  • A certified Medical Review Officer (MRO) should review results when necessary.
  • Record keeping and procedural documentation should be diligent, with well-defined follow-up actions post positive results.

What Is a Hair Drug Screen?

In Grandview, IA, hair drug screening analyzes small hair samples to detect drugs and their metabolites that have circulated in the bloodstream and settled in the hair shaft. Thus, it offers one of the longest detection windows – ideal for identifying consistent or long-term drug use within the state.

  • The typical requirement is 100-120 strands cut close to the scalp, approximately 1.5 inches in length.
  • This reflects around a 90-day detection period, contingent on the hair length being analyzed in Grandview, IA.
  • In Grandview, IA testing, varied substance detection is feasible, including amphetamines, opioids, cocaine, marijuana, and PCP.

Why Organizations Use Hair Drug Screening

  • Employers in Grandview, IA might use pre-employment testing to uncover long-term drug use.
  • Random or scheduled workplace tests are prevalent in safety-sensitive industries per Grandview, IAn standards.
  • Programs geared towards compliance monitoring either in treatment settings or legal mandates often involve hair testing.
  • It's instrumental in verifying lifestyle abstinence or ensuring adherence to company drug-free directives.

How It Works

Collection

  • A certified collector trims a small section of hair (typically from the crown) in accordance with strict custody regulations.
  • The sample is sealed, marked, and sent to a certified laboratory.
  • If scalp hair is not available, alternative areas, such as body hair, may be utilized.

Testing Methodology

  • In the Grandview, IA, samples undergo a cleaning process to remove any external contaminants prior to analysis.
  • Initial screening employs immunoassay techniques to identify different drug categories.
  • Upon yielding positive screening results, further validation is conducted using GC/MS or LC/MS/MS methodologies for precise substance identification.
  • Established cutoff levels are defined in ng/mg, following SAMHSA and other pertinent laboratory guidelines.

Interpreting Results

  • Negative: No indication of drugs or metabolites surpassing the laboratory's cutoff criteria.
  • Positive: Verifiably detected presence of drugs or metabolites, confirmed through supplementary testing methods.
  • Inconclusive/Rejected: Situations such as insufficient sample size or contamination necessitating recollection for a definitive outcome.

Detection Windows

Hair drug testing prevailing in Grandview, IA boasts the longest detection window current among testing approaches. A typical hair sample of 1.5 inches can exhibit around 90 days of prior drug exposure. Extended samples can lengthen the window, subject to the growth rate, approximately 0.5 inches monthly. Unlike urine or oral testing, hair assessments are not feasible for recent drug usage (within the last 7–10 days).

Key Considerations for Regulated and Non-Regulated Testing

  • Although DOT guidelines presently don't enforce hair testing, ongoing evaluations by the Department of Transportation and HHS are considering future adoption.
  • Outside of DOT mandates, hair testing is upheld as effective in identifying long-term drug usage.
  • Qualified specialists should oversee collection, maintaining documented chain-of-custody compliance.
  • Laboratory accuracy and dependability are endorsed through SAMHSA or CAP/CLIA accreditation in Grandview, IA.

Benefits

  • Hair testing in Grandview, IA offers an extensive detection timeline, reaching up to 90 days or more, making it ideal for assessing long-term substance use.
  • Due to the nature of the test, it is challenging to adulterate or substitute compared to urine samples.
  • It helps establish clear patterns of ongoing or recurrent substance use.
  • Hair sample collection is straightforward and non-invasive, as it does not require restroom facilities.
